Bret Michaels ‘Not Completely Out of the Woods Yet’ from Skin Cancer Scare

Bret Michaels shared in January 2020 that he underwent a biopsy that detected skin cancer. At that time, the Poison frontman underwent a procedure to remove the cancer. However, he recently had another scare, which he details via social media.

Michaels wrote, “Just knowing that I absolutely love the outdoors & the sun, but with the recent passing of my friend Jimmy Buffett, I decided it was time for a more recent check-up of something I thought was nothing. Turns out, it was something.”

Buffett died in September at age 76 after a private battle with skin cancer.

Michaels noted that he was able to undergo a procedure to remove the cancer literally the day of a show. He shared a photo of the scar he has from the procedure. Michaels said he’s “not completely out of the woods yet.” However, he also said the procedure likely saved his life, or, at the very least, extended it.

Back in 2020, Michaels shared in a statement, “After a very recent kickoff to the new year, physical & MRI, it has been brought to my attention that I have torn my right shoulder rotator cuff which would answer the question why it looks like a lump or bone was sticking out of my right shoulder. A little more complex, I will also have to undergo a procedure to remove skin cancer that was detected after a recent biopsy.”
